Three legendary comedians... One very unusual dressing room.Dying is easy, Comedy is hard.The Last laugh is a "brilliant" (The Telegraph) smash-hit West-End play which imagines three of Britain's all-time greatest comedy heroes - Tommy Cooper, Eric Morecambe, and Bob Monkhouse - in a dressing room, discussing the secret of life, death, comedy, and what it means to be funny... really funny."Lovingly written and directed" (Sunday Times) by the award-winning Paul Hendy, The Last Laugh stars Damian Williams as Cooper, Simon Cartwright as Monkhouse, and Britain's Got Talent finalist Steve Royle as Morecambe.Warm, funny, nostalgic, and poignant, The Last Laugh is "pure gold" and "pitch perfect" (Mail on Sunday), and will have you laughing and crying in equal measure. If you're a fan of comedy this "irresistible blissful blast of nostalgia and belly laughs" (Sunday Express) is not to be missed!
